Chris Watts murdered his pregnant wife Shanann and their daughters Bella (4) and Celeste (3) in Frederick, Colorado. He disposed of their bodies at his work site. He was sentenced to life.

On August 13, 2018, Chris Watts strangled his pregnant wife Shanann (34) in their bed in their home in Frederick, Colorado. He then drove to a remote oil field work site with Shanann's body and their two daughters Bella (4) and Celeste (3), who were still alive.

At the work site, Watts smothered Bella and Celeste and disposed of their bodies in oil tanks. He buried Shanann in a shallow grave nearby. He then reported his family missing and made emotional public pleas for their return.

Within days, investigators identified inconsistencies in Watts's story. Surveillance footage, GPS data, and a failed polygraph led to his arrest. He initially blamed Shanann for killing the children, then confessed to all three murders.

Watts pleaded guilty to nine charges including first-degree murder and was sentenced to five life terms without parole. The case was the subject of the 2020 Netflix documentary 'American Murder: The Family Next Door.'
